Job Search and Career Advice Platform

Enable job alerts via email!

Brand Marketing Manager

Square Peg Associates

Manchester

On-site

GBP 40,000 - 60,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ment consultancy in Manchester is seeking an experienced marketing professional to drive brand awareness and manage strategic projects. You will be responsible for developing marketing campaigns and enhancing collaboration across teams. The ideal candidate should have a strong background in performance marketing, project management skills, and the ability to work with various stakeholders. This role offers competitive pay and excellent benefits, with a few days of required travel to the Head Office in Lancashire.

Benefits

Competitive salary
Excellent benefits
Dynamic team environment

Qualifications

  • Proven experience in marketing and brand management.
  • Strong background in performance marketing and lead generation.
  • Excellent project management skills and attention to detail.

Responsibilities

  • Create and implement marketing campaigns that communicate brand value.
  • Manage marketing budget ownership and spend optimisation.
  • Collaborate with senior management teams across multiple projects.

Skills

Cross-team collaboration
Market research
Audience segmentation
Brand health metrics
Performance measurement
Creative development
Job description

Square Peg Associates is working with a highly customer‑centric company whose product ranges, designs and innovation are continually taking the business to the next level.

We’ve created a new opportunity to be responsible for several strategic projects that enhance and underpin the brand visibility, performance and drive sales across UK, EU and Globally.

You will grow brand awareness and strengthen relationships with valued partners, agents and distributor networks. You will be responsible for creating and implementing marketing campaigns, and promotions that effectively communicate brand value and product portfolio.

The role is broad in scope covering responsibility for customer insight, marketing mix choices (channels and investment levels), marketing budget ownership and spend optimisation, agency management, measurement/ evaluation and reporting results to senior leaders.

The ideal candidate has a track record of success in marketing and brand management, and a strong background in performance marketing and lead generation campaigns.

You also have proven experience managing priorities and working effectively across a number of internal stakeholders, strong project management skills, attention to detail, and an entrepreneurial, creative spirit with passion and energy.

The role is based in Manchester City Centre and will require a few days over at Head Office in Lancashire, therefore a car owner is essential.

The salary on offer is highly competitive with excellent benefits. We will go through the full scope of the package upon application or please contact Square Peg Associates for further detail.

What we are looking for
  • Experience and influence in cross‑team collaboration across multiple projects. Support the development of the overall integrated marketing and brand strategy
  • Own the market research and brand strategy to identify insights and targeting strategies.
  • Possess a deep understanding of our audience segmentation and digital product.
  • Own the measurement framework, inclusive of brand health metrics and channel attribution models.
  • Run creative and message testing across the marketing funnel and different channels to drive perception and engagement.
  • Collaborate cross‑functionally with senior management teams to deliver a best in class experience across the marketing funnel. Experience using data, reporting, or tools to measure performance and make adjustments accordingly
  • Experience guiding creative input, development and execution from concept to completion – whether this is in‑house or use of external agencies

This role is truly exciting, engaging and you will be part of a wider Marketing Team where you can exchange and pull on resource, collateral and creative design expertise.

Join this dynamic team and contribute to the continued growth! If you’re an ambitious individual with a passion for your work, we’d love to hear from you.
About Square Peg Associates
At Square Peg Associates, we are a leading recruitment consultancy specialising in finance and commercial business professionals within the North West of England. Our approach is personal and tailored to each candidate. We not only consider the qualifications listed on their CVs but also take the time to understand them on a deeper level. Before representing any candidate to our esteemed client base, we build strong relationships with them. If you’re interested in exploring our current vacancies, visit our website at Squarepegassociates.co.uk.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.